Choosing the Right Games
Not all casino games are created equal. Some games offer better odds than others. For instance, table games such as blackjack or baccarat often provide more favorable return-to-player percentages compared to slot machines. Before you engage in play, it’s crucial to research and understand the games that are known for offering higher odds. The overall experience of gambling can also be influenced by your choice of game selection.
Selecting the right game also involves knowing your strengths. If you excel at strategic thinking, consider games that require skill, such as poker. Conversely, if you prefer games of chance, choose those with lower house edges. Being informed about the games you select can significantly impact your overall winnings.
Bankroll Management Strategies
Effective bankroll management is one of the unseen secrets to successful gambling. Establish a budget before you start playing and stick to it. By defining how much money you’re willing to spend, you can avoid falling into the trap of chasing losses. This discipline helps to preserve your capital over a longer period, offering you more opportunities to win. Additionally, consider dividing your bankroll into smaller segments for different sessions or games. This way, you can manage your funds better and reduce the temptation to gamble more than you can afford. Understanding when to walk away—whether you’re ahead or have hit your limit—is crucial in maintaining a healthy approach to gambling.
